Bibliometric Analysis of Scientific Studies Performed with Mathematical Modelling
Abstract
This bibliometric study analyzes scientific publications in mathematical modeling to identify trends and key contributors. While research showed an upward trajectory over the past decade, a decline since 2018 was noted, primarily in English publications. Internationally recognized institutions lead in contributions, often published by major publishers. The study offers a broad overview, potentially guiding future research. Distribution analysis considers contributions and country trends, with the United States leading but notable input from China, Indonesia, and Spain. Citation networks among authors and their affiliated institutions demonstrate frequent collaboration. In conclusion, this study illuminates research dynamics in mathematical modeling, laying groundwork for future endeavors.
